Key Responsibilities

  • •Act as a liaison between clients, Financial Advisors, and back-office operations to support client service.
  • •Assist Financial Advisors and maintain/satisfy client needs for brokerage and direct accounts.
  • •Communicate with internal teammates and external parties to exchange information and provide customer service.
  • •Establish, maintain, and update department and client files and records, compiling data and preparing reports and correspondence.
  • •Ensure compliance with company policies and applicable laws/regulations, and mentor Client Assistant I & II positions.

Key Requirements

  • •High school diploma (higher education degree preferred).
  • •Minimum 5-7 years of experience in the financial services industry.
  • •2+ years as a Registered Client Assistant (required).
  • •FINRA registrations including SIE, Series 7 or 6, and 63 (required).
  • •Virginia life insurance and annuities licenses (required).
